TypeScript语言的网络编程 引言 在现代软件开发中,网络编程是一个不可或缺的部分。随着互联网的快速发展,网络应用程序越来越普遍,涉及到从简单的个人网站到复杂的企业级应用。TypeScript作为一种强类型的JavaScript超集,近年来…
2025/1/11 12:28:48如何设置i18n在该软件设置过语言的情况下优先选择所设置语言,在没有设置的情况下,获取本系统默认语言就,将系统默认语言设置为当前选择语言。 1、下载依赖: npm install vue-i18n --save 2、创建相关文件(在最外层&…
2025/1/11 10:09:231.归并排序 时间复杂度O(NlogN),额外空间复杂度(N) 求出中间位置,先将左侧排好序,再将右侧排好序,最后将整体整合,不断重复上述过程直到将整个数组排序 如何整合: 定义两个指针指向左右两个子数组最左侧的位置 pub…
2025/1/11 9:25:03今天继续给大家分享一道力扣的做题心得今天这道题目是 912.排序数组 题目链接:912. 排序数组 - 力扣(LeetCode) 题目:给你一个整数数组 nums,请你将该数组升序排列。 你必须在 不使用任何内置函数 的情况下解决问题…
2025/1/11 9:04:25异或运算法则 1. a ^ b b ^ a 2. a ^ b ^ c a ^ (b ^ c) (a ^ b) ^ c; 3. d a ^ b ^ c 可以推出 a d ^ b ^ c. 4. a ^ b ^ a b. 异或运算 1、异或是一个数学运算符。应用于逻辑运算。 2、例如:真异或假的结果是真,假异或真的结果也是真&#x…
2025/1/11 12:25:54 人评论 次浏览备份文/爱掏蜂窝的熊(简书作者)原文链接:http://www.jianshu.com/p/0b6f5148dab8著作权归作者所有,转载请联系作者获得授权,并标注“简书作者”。序 在日常开发中,app难免会发生崩溃。简单的崩溃…
2025/1/11 12:04:44 人评论 次浏览1,空指针和索引越界 ArrayIndexOutOfBoundsException:数组索引越界异常 原因:你访问了不存在的索引。 b:NullPointerException:空指针异常 原因:数组已经不在指向堆内存了。而你还用数组名去访问元素。 【1】ArrayIndexOutOfBoundsExcepti…
2025/1/11 11:30:03 人评论 次浏览今天介绍一下django开发中,定义模型时用到的相关字段类型和字段选项。先说说常用的字段类型:1) AutoField: 自增字段类型,当自定义自增类型的id时,可以使用此类型;2) BigAutoField: 64位的整数自增类型;3) BigIntegerF…
2025/1/11 10:35:24 人评论 次浏览传送门:poj 1077 Eight 题目大意 输入的八数码 将一个八数码最后转换为 1 2 3 4 5 6 7 8 x 的格式,然后打印出路径 康拓展开 如果按照平常的思路,把x的位置看做0,一共有8!个状态,来判断某一个状态…
2025/1/11 12:34:58 人评论 次浏览首先说思路,在mybatis中防止sql注入,目前只能在Controller层进行转义,后台sql进行查询,然后在controller层转义回来,返回到前台。 理论上应该可以在dao.xml中进行判断 但是目前还没写出来。Orz 上代码 RequiresPerm…
2025/1/11 12:33:58 人评论 次浏览本文作者:CODING 用户 - 廖石荣 持续集成的概念 持续集成(Continuous integration,简称 CI)是一种软件开发实践,即团队开发成员经常集成他们的工作,通常每个成员每天至少集成一次,也就意味着每天可能会发生多次集成。每…
2025/1/11 12:32:57 人评论 次浏览1. AOP的相关概念1.1 AOP概述1.1.1 什么是AOPAOP:全程是Aspect Oriented Programming 即面向切面编程。是通过预编译方式和运行期动态代理实现程序功能的统一维护的一种技术。AOP是OOP的延续,是软件开发中的一个热点,也是Spring框架中的一个重…
2025/1/11 12:31:57 人评论 次浏览3.2 mixer接口int register_sound_mixer(structfile_operations *fops, int dev);上述函数用于注册1个混音器,第1个参数fops即是文件操作接口,第2个参数dev是设备编号,如果填入-1,则系统自动分配1个设备编号。mixer 是 1个典型的字…
2025/1/11 12:30:56 人评论 次浏览一个:java 和c参考控制他提到引用,我们会想到java它不喜欢c里面的指针。当然java内引用和c里面的引用是不同的。比如:比方C中,我对某一个函数的声明。int a(int &b),b即为引用类型,函数内b的改动能够影…
2025/1/11 12:29:56 人评论 次浏览最近不管我在互联网看新闻、看视频或者看公众号文章,甚至我在淘宝的时候都会看到一个词,那就是“Python”,我也不知道我对它做了什么,为什么老是给我推送Python?甚至我和程序员朋友沟通的时候,也会扯到Pyth…
2024/12/9 22:08:12 人评论 次浏览<text>属性介绍 (x,y)是文本左下角的坐标dx(dx1,……)是文本相对基点x向右偏移的距离dy(dy1,……)是文本相对基点y向下偏移的距离text-anchor文本相对基点&#x…
2024/12/23 0:43:58 人评论 次浏览1.业务需求:从三个表拿出数据然后合并为一个数组,然后对数组进行分页 2. 解决1:合并数组 获取三个表的数据,然后使用array_column来处理 array_cloumn()第一个参数是数据,第二是字段名 处理结果 3. 对数组进行分页…
2025/1/2 10:21:20 人评论 次浏览写在前面 刚入职一家新公司,在对接app的时候需要获取到某公司的sharepoint上面的文档库,获取文档库列表,团队文档库中的文件和文件夹列表,个人文档库中的文件文件夹列表,及在app端进入文件夹的时候需要获取该文件夹下的…
2025/1/6 7:42:52 人评论 次浏览今天用nodejs和socket.io实现在线聊天功能。总结一下socket.io的基本用法 首先安装socket包 npm install socket.io在服务器端引用 const socketio require("socket.io");安装完包,引用这个socket的js文件 。他的路径node_modules/socket.io-client/d…
2024/12/28 22:31:03 人评论 次浏览vector中元素连续存储,容器必须分配新的内存空间,将已有元素从旧位置分配到新的空间中,然后添加新元素,释放就存储空间,复杂度会很大。 1) c.reverse(n): 分配至少能容纳n个元素的内存。 只有当需要的内存空间超过当…
2025/1/8 22:50:39 人评论 次浏览